On AUG. 29 actor Gene Wilder sadly passed away at the age of 83. The star’s nephew informed the Associated Press of the actor’s death and confirmed he passed at his home in Stamford, Connecticut, due to complications from Alzheimer’s disease.
In his statement, Jordan Walker-Pearlman (Wilder’s nephew) said “Wilder was diagnosed with the disease three years ago, but kept the condition private so as not to disappoint fans.”
Following the news, A-listers have taken to social media to send their condolences to the iconic star.
Sarah Jessica Parker, 51, posted a vintage snap, captioning it: “My first crush. The brilliantly funny Gene Wilder. Those blue eyes and unique comedic gifts a potent and seductive combination. R.I.P. x, sj.”
Ben Stiller, 50, also commended Wilder for his acting skills as a final goodbye. The actor tweeted, “Gene Wilder. Best ever at what he did. #RIP.”
